101 licensure exams slated in 2021, says Professional Regulation Commission

By VIRGIL LOPEZ,GMA News

A total of 101 licensure examinations will be conducted this year after strict lockdowns aimed at curbing the spread of COVID-19 forced the cancellations of many exams in 2020, the Professional Regulation Commission (PRC) said Thursday.

The PRC held only 11 exams last year as compared to 83 exams in 2019, said PRC Chairperson Teofilo Pilando Jr. at the Laging Handa briefing.

“Kaya ngayon, to make up, we have scheduled 101 licensure examinations for 2021,” Pilando said.

“Unfortunately, may mga iba pa ring mga professional boards na nagri-recommend ng cancelation dahil for various reasons upon consultation from their respective examinees, sa academe as well as the professional organizations.”

The government’s COVID-19 response task force earlier allowed the conduct of licensure examinations scheduled for January to March this year.

According to the PRC, the professional exams set to take place from January to March include those for architects, veterinarians, medical technologists, teachers, social workers, physicians and geologists, among others.

Pilando said health protocols must be strictly observed during the exams.

“We strictly implement iyong mga health protocols for these examinations kagaya ng PCR test or quarantine para sa examinees and examination personnel and pinadamihan namin ang mga examination venue para hindi na kailangan bumiyahe ang mga examinees as much as possible,” he said.

“And at the same time, sa venue mismo, we lessen the capacity from the usual 24 examinees per room to 8 para may social distancing.”

The PRC has also coordinated with the Department of Health and local government units with regard to the conduct of the exams.

“We are happy to know they are very cooperative,” Pilando said.

Pilando added the PRC is eyeing to introduce computer-based licensure examinations later this year.

“Bago pa man ang pandemic, pinag-aaralan na namin iyong computer-based licensure examinations. Pinag-aaralan lang namin iyong mga batas ng bawat propesyon at saka iyong mga issues and privacy, security and then appropriate technology,” he said.

“Hopefully before the end of the year, mako-conduct  na namin at least for the small boards, meaning iyong mga boards na kakaunti lang ang mga examinees para mas manageable.” -NB/MDM, GMA News
